Microsoft has been very fond of Solitaire games since the beginning. Microsoft Solitaire Collection is a video game combined with the Windows 10 operating system.Microsoft Solitaire Collection is a consolidation of several Solitaire games, which comes pre-installed in Windows 10. It displaces Solitaire, FreeCell and Spider Solitaire included with the earlier variants of Windows. It also adds Pyramid and TriPeaks to Windows for the first time and introduces new daily challenges and themes.
